David Field 1830–1900 – Genealogical Records
Birth Date: 1830
Birth Location: Whipsnade, Bedfordshire, England
Death Date: 4 August 1900
Death Location: St Mary's Street, Dunstable
Father: Thomas Field
Mother: Mary Hall
Spouse(s): Ann Impey
Children(s): Jesse Field
The story of David Field began in 1830 in Whipsnade, Bedfordshire, England. David Field married Ann Impey, and had children including Jesse Field. David Field passed away in 1900 in St Mary's Street, Dunstable.
